Which of the following is NOT considered a common source of voice latency?

Explanation:
Voice latency mainly comes from three kinds of delays: propagation, queuing, and processing. Propagation delay is the time it takes for the voice signal to traverse the physical path, increasing with distance. Queuing delay happens when packets wait in buffers at routers during congestion. Processing delays cover the time devices spend encoding, decoding, packetizing, and making forwarding decisions. Encryption overhead, while it can add some processing time, is not typically treated as a separate common latency source in standard voice-latency models; it’s absorbed into the overall processing delay. So encryption overhead isn’t considered a separate common source of voice latency.
